Abstract

By employing a chiral bifunctional thiourea–tertiary amine as catalyst, domino Michael-type Friedel–Crafts alkylation/cyclization of β-naphthols with akylidene Meldrum’s acids was realized. The reactions afforded various enantioenriched β-arylsplitomicins with good yields (up to 99%) in moderate enantio­selectivities (up to 79%).
